Systeemityö 2 Kokoava vuorovaikutuskaavio - (Interaction overview diagram) Roni Ukonaho, Juha-Pekka Remes, Aki Nikula.

Slides:



Advertisements
Samankaltaiset esitykset
@ Leena Lahtinen Helia Ohjelman perusrakenteet 1. PERÄKKÄISRAKENNE 2. VALINTARAKENNE 3. TOISTORAKENNE.
Advertisements

Ohjelmiston tekninen suunnittelu
JavaScript (c) Irja & Reino Aarinen, 2007
Ohjelman perusrakenteet
VOICE THREAD Kieltenopetuksen apuvälineenä. K IELITAITO Kieltä käytetään ajatusten välittämiseen, sosiaalisten suhteiden ylläpitämiseen ja diskurssin.
HTML-kielen perusteet Osa 5 Vilho Kemppainen
BPMN ja hiukan prosessien määrittelystä
AS Automaation signaalinkäsittelymenetelmät
OHJELMAN OSITTAMINEN LUOKKA ATTRIBUUTIT METODIT. LUOKKA JAVA ohjelma koostuu luokista LUOKKA sisältää metodeja molemmat sisältävät attribuutteja eli muuttujia.
@ Leena Lahtinen OHJELMAN OSITTAMINEN LUOKKA ATTRIBUUTIT METODIT.
Oliomallittaminen ja UML
Teemaryhmä Opintoasiainpäivät Sihteeri Tuula Kivistö
Ohjelman perusrakenteet
Millaisia tiedonkäsityksiä on olemassa
2. Vuokaaviot.
Tutkimussuunnitelman ja opinnäytetyön rakenne
Punainen: tunteet, vaistot - Millaisia tunteita ja tuntemuksia tehtävä herättää? Musta: varovaisuus, arviointi, kriittisyys - Mitkä ovat ehdotuksen hyvät.
Käyttöönottokaavio – Deployment diagram Sami Stenius.
Heikki Salokanto Valvoja: prof. Jukka Manner Ohjaaja: DI Pekka Pajuoja, TEKES Sovelluskehitysympäristön virtualisoinnin tuomat edut ja haitat.
Systeemityö 2 Tilakaavio – State machine diagram
@ Leena Lahtinen OHJELMAN OSITTAMINEN LUOKKA ATTRIBUUTIT METODIT.
Systeemityö 2 Ajoituskaavio – Timing Diagram
Toistorakenne Toistorakennetta käytetään ohjelmissa sellaisissa tilanteissa, joissa jotain tiettyä ohjelmassa tapahtuvaa toimenpidekokonaisuutta halutaan.
Systeemityö 2 Toimintokaavio – Activity diagram
DTD Teppo Räisänen Liiketalouden yksikkö.
Package diagram Tiia Jefremoff
Koostekaavio – Composite Structure Diagram Kinnula – Kellolampi - Lehtosaari.
@ Leena Lahtinen Toistorakenne Ohjelmassa toistetaan tiettyjä toimenpiteitä monta kertaa peräkkäin Toisto noudattaa sille kuuluvia tarkkoja standardoituja.
Systeemityö 2 Kokoava vuorovaikutuskaavio – Interaction
© 2010 IBM Corporation1 Palautesivun esittely  Palautesivua käytetään pääasiassa palautteen lähettämiseen virastoihin. Palautesivun pitäisi löytyä jokaisesta.
Kuvakäsikirjoitus Jonna ja Sara. Ensimmäinen kohtaus Kohtauksen sisältö: Luokassa keskustellaan yhteisistä käyttäytymissäännöistä.  yleiskuva luokkahuoneesta.
Ajoituskaavio– Timing diagram Olli-Pekka Jokinen Aleksi Alapuranen tik9sna.
Aakkosnumeerinen tieto Tarkoittaa kaikkea muuta tietoa paitsi laskentaan tarkoitettuja lukuja Muuttujan tietosisältö on siis tekstitietoa Muuttujan tietotyypiksi.
Komponenttikaavio Lehtonen Iiro, Janne Liikka
Component diagram– Komponenttikaavio J. Pätsi & H. Malmihuhta
Kontrollirakenteet laajemmin
Security-Enhanced Linux. Sisällys Yleistä Taustaa Toiminta Tulevaisuus Ongelmat Lähteet.
Sequence Diagram Jani Keskitapio, Annika Alakastari, Heng Qing Zhu TIK9SNA.
Käyttöönottokaavio– Deployment diagram Vesa Jokikokko Tarmo Kemi TIK9SNA.
Opiskelun ja opetuksen tukipalveluiden ja hallinnon viitearkkitehtuuri Pekka Linna, CSC.
Toistorakenne Toistorakennetta käytetään ohjelmissa sellaisissa tilanteissa, joissa jotain tiettyä ohjelmassa tapahtuvaa toimenpidekokonaisuutta halutaan.
XSL Teppo Räisänen
XSL Teppo Räisänen
Systeemityö 2 Viestiyhteyskaavio (Sekvenssi kaavio) – Sequence diagram
Ohjelmistojen mallintaminen, sekvenssikaaviot
Pakkauskaavio– Package Diagram Jani Pelkonen, Niko Viinikanoja, Teemu Tervahauta.
Koostekaavio– composite structure diagram Mikko Näpänkangas.
Valintarakenne valintarakenne alkaa aina kysymyksellä eli ehdolla ehto tarkoittaa, että muuttujan sisältöä verrataan toisen muuttujan sisältöön tai vakioon.
Projektin kirjalliset työt. Muistiot Ryhmän sisäinen tiedon tallentamisen muoto Päätökset voidaan palauttaa mieleen Poissaolija saa tiedon päätöksistä.
Toistorakenne Toistorakennetta käytetään ohjelmissa sellaisissa tilanteissa, joissa jotain tiettyä ohjelmassa tapahtuvaa toimenpidekokonaisuutta halutaan.
Rullalautailu ”Skeittaus”. Mitä rullalautailu on? Laudalla liikkumista paikasta toiseen Erilaisten temppujen tekemistä – Monesti samanaikaisesti Harrastus.
Palautetaidot ja opponointi Rinna Toikka. Opponoinnin tarkoitus Oppia lukemaan kriittisesti Laajentaa näkökulmaa Synnyttää tieteellistä keskustelua Auttaa.
Excel kaikille lyhyesti ja helposti Kaaviot Kakkospainikkeen pikavalikko on tehokas työväline.
Laadunhallintajärjestelmä/ laatujärjestelmä
Toistorakenne Toistorakennetta käytetään ohjelmissa sellaisissa tilanteissa, joissa jotain tiettyä ohjelmassa tapahtuvaa toimenpidekokonaisuutta halutaan.
Posterin otsikko Ohjeita Alaotsikkko
Excelpäälliköintiä Power Query VINKKI SOLUTIONS | MIKAEL AHONEN.
Helsingin normaalilyseo Jani Kiviharju syksy 2016
Sekvenssikaavio– Sequence diagram Lassi Kemppainen
Oikea palvelut oikeaan aikaan
Aakkosnumeerinen tieto
Toisto Toistolausekkeet for, while(ehto){…} ja do {…} while(ehto)
Aakkosnumeerinen tieto
Työnteon monet tilat, osa II
Vapaudesta, vastuusta ja vallasta – kurkistus sosiaali- ja terveydenhuollon isojen sanojen taakse Juha Teperi
Ohjelmistotekniikan menetelmät, sekvenssikaaviot
Kontrollirakenteet laajemmin
Ohjelman perusrakenteet
Eläkeliiton Ylä-Savon piiri ry./Pekka Mäkinen
Case-linkit sana&search[asiasana]=Yhteistoimintamenettely
Esityksen transkriptio:

Systeemityö 2 Kokoava vuorovaikutuskaavio - (Interaction overview diagram) Roni Ukonaho, Juha-Pekka Remes, Aki Nikula

Kokoava vuorovaikutuskaavio Yleistä kaaviosta Kokoava vuorovaikutuskaavio sisältää sarjan käyttäytymiskaavioita korostamaan vuorovaikutuksessa olevien elementtien toimintaa järjestelmässä Mitä kaaviolla mallinnetaan? Kaaviota käytetään mallintamaan ohjelman logiikkaa tai muuta suurehkoa tilannetta kuten isoa käyttötapausta, jossa täytyy yhdistellä useita eri vuorovaikutuskaavioita yhteen kuvaan

Kokoava vuorovaikutuskaavio Milloin kaaviota käytetään Silloin kun halutaan saada järjestelmästä hyvä kokonaiskuva.

Kokoava vuorovaikutuskaavio Päätöksessä haarautuneiden ketjujen yhdistäminen. Mallinnuselementit Aukipiirretty vuorovaikutuskaavio on sd-kehyksen sisällä. sd Päätöksentekokohta, jossa toiminta haarautuu ehtojen mukaan. Ehto 1 Ehto 2 ref Viittaus vuorovaikutuskaavioon. Liittyminen Aloituspiste, josta toiminta lähtee liikkeelle. Lopetuspiste, johon kaavion toiminta päättyy. Haarautuminen

Kokoava vuorovaikutuskaavio Esimerkkikaavio 1

Kokoava vuorovaikutuskaavio Esimerkkikaavio 2 ATM-casesta

Kokoava vuorovaikutuskaavio Yhteenveto Vähä niinku toimintakaavio Voi yhdistellä eri vuorovaikutuskaavioita